Output e12de3bb4dad8d49fc72bcd902631b7ae761354c09656b7200927ea3df666b83:20

value
380882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a504866c258ea654f4772e1f0cec56786aae4bb OP_EQUAL
address
3469fgMWzkHoUeW2pHJF5MLDgmgx3QSqpJ
transaction
e12de3bb4dad8d49fc72bcd902631b7ae761354c09656b7200927ea3df666b83
confirmations
224376
spent
true